Reading Buddies Program At The Leland Family Resource Center (LFRC)

Reading Buddies Program

Pictured Left To Right: Damian Pritchard (10th Grader at North Brunswick High School) and Chris Pritchard (6th Grader at Roger Bacon Academy).

September 15, 2011 - Leland, NC - This summer the "Reading Buddies" program at the Leland Family Resource Center (LFRC) paired young students with older students and grandparents to work on reading skills. After a successful trial run, the program is being extended into the school year. "Young readers enjoy the one-on-one attention and it transfers to an enjoyment of the reading experience," explains Margaret Roseman, LFRC Site Director. Enrollment of elementary school students is underway. High school and middle school students are needed as volunteer Reading Buddies. The LFRC is a program of Communities In Schools of Brunswick County, Inc. For more information, call 371-5411 or visit www.cisbrunswick.org.
